Description

Set in the tumultuous 1660s, Jamaica's vibrant yet dangerous landscape serves as the backdrop for a gripping tale of intrigue and adventure. The island, caught between Spanish occupation and English and French settlements, is a melting pot of cultures and conflicts. Tensions rise as competing nations vie for control, and the clash of empires casts shadows over the lives of those who call this exotic place home.

Amidst the chaos, a daring corsair emerges, navigating treacherous waters both on the sea and within the colonial society. With cunning and bravery, he seeks fortune and freedom, delving into a world of piracy, betrayal, and fragile alliances. The thrilling escapades unveil the harsh realities of life as a privateer, offering glimpses into the morality and motivations that drive individuals in their quest for power.

As allegiances shift and battles rage, the corsair must confront not only external enemies but also the demons of his own past. In this rich tapestry of history and adventure, the struggle for survival is a testament to the indomitable spirit of those who dare to challenge the status quo in a world where danger is ever-present and loyalty is a rare commodity.
